Nicholas Pooran Rues Loss In 2nd ODI, Says West Indies "Need To Continue To Be Aggressive"

West Indies stand-in skipper Nicholas Pooran expressed disappointment after his side was defeated by India in the second ODI of the three-match series at the Narendra Modi Stadium in Ahmedabad on Wednesday. Prasidh Krishna's four-wicket haul helped India defend 237 and defeat West Indies by 44 runs in the second ODI. "With the bat, we didn't build partnerships. We kept losing wickets at regular intervals. In the 39th over, we lost Fabian first and then Hosein in the very next. We need to continue to be aggressive. Pollard is a tough and big guy and should be back. Smith is a strong guy. He is a little inexperienced but sky is the limit for him. We did a good job with the ball and hopefully we can do the same in the final game. And also do better with the bat," Pooran said after the game.

Indian women's team suffers 18-run loss to New Zealand in one-off T20 International

Senior opener and vice-captain Smriti Mandhana did not play and her absence was felt badly as India fell short by 18 runs while chasing 156 for a win. Rookie Yastika Bhatia, who opened in place of Mandhana along with young Shafali Verma, did reasonably well with a run-a-ball 26 (2x4; 1x6) but India never looked like they could chase down the target against an impressive New Zealand bowling attack. The opening stand was worth 41 runs in 6.3 overs and that was the highest partnership for India.
